1. EIA report: US crude oil exports decreased by 91,000 barrels per day to 4.27 million barrels per day in the week of June 20. 2. EIA report: US domestic crude oil production increased by 4,000 barrels to 13.435 million barrels per day in the week of June 20. 3. EIA report: Commercial crude oil inventories excluding strategic reserves decreased by 5.836 million barrels to 415 million barrels, a decrease of 1.39%. 4. EIA report: The four-week average supply of US crude oil products was 20.049 million barrels per day, a decrease of 1.6% from the same period last year. 5. EIA report: US Strategic Petroleum Reserve (SPR) inventories increased by 237,000 barrels to 402.5 million barrels in the week of June 20, an increase of 0.06%. 6. EIA report: US commercial crude oil imports excluding strategic reserves were 5.944 million barrels per day in the week of June 20, an increase of 440,000 barrels per day from the previous week.
